Output 26316412e752449842e49b053a9cb14b21df1ae8dec98cc11bc88afee309069a:6

value
37523421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37c8793e112d305e41bed77c533f7a0bb710c33 OP_EQUAL
address
3NRrVZHv9Q8Z8NTHnpa92WW3kkHHQfXDQV
transaction
26316412e752449842e49b053a9cb14b21df1ae8dec98cc11bc88afee309069a
confirmations
269042
spent
true